Water Leak Detection: What You Need to Know
Water leak detection is a critical service that involves identifying and repairing hidden leaks in your home’s plumbing system. In the 98509 area, water leaks are a common problem, especially during the winter months when pipes are more prone to freezing and bursting. If left undetected, water leaks can cause significant damage to your home’s structure, including warping floors, stained ceilings, and ruined drywall.

Water Leak Detection: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| Easy to clean and fix, no significant damage expected.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Significant damage expected, needs professional equipment and expertise.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Hidden damage, needs professional inspection and repair. |
| Leaky faucet in the kitchen | Yes | No | Easy to fix, no significant damage expected. |
| Basement flood after heavy rainfall | No | Yes | Significant damage expected, needs professional equipment and expertise. |
| Hidden water leak behind walls | No | Yes | Needs professional inspection and repair, hidden damage. |

What are the signs of a hidden water leak?
A hidden water leak can be difficult to detect, but common signs include water stains on walls or ceilings, warped floors, and musty odors. If you suspect a hidden water leak, contact us today to schedule a consultation and get expert guidance on how to detect and repair the leak.
